Managing Balance Validation Rules

Objectives

After completing this lesson, you will be able to:
  • 残高チェックルールの構造を相互運用します。
  • 残高チェックの基本ルールの登録
  • 残高チェック基本ルールのシミュレーション
  • 残高チェックの複合ルールの登録

残高チェックルール構造

マックスは残高検証の基本コンセプトを理解しており、プロセスをより深く掘り下げたいと考えています。マックスは残高チェックプロセスをレビューし、必要な基準に照らしてデータを分析するためにルールを登録する必要があることを理解しています。この基準には、特定の期間 (原価センタや G/L 勘定など) に対する変更 (多かれ少なかれ) を特定するための計算の使用が含まれます。

比較タイプは、分析中のデータによって異なります。たとえば、自転車会社の場合、マックスは以下の方法で会社の経時的な費用を分析することができます。

  • 営業費用勘定間の原価センタの差異が前月と 5% の差異を超えていないことをチェックします。
  • 給与賃金などの個別の G/L 勘定を確認し、格差が 1.5% 以下であることを確認する

貸借対照表勘定の場合、最大で現在の残高をチェックすることができます。たとえば、固定資産勘定残高を確認する場合、減価償却累計額が取得価額を超えていないことを確認する必要があります。

注記

ルールは会社のポリシーに基づいて異なり、直接作成することも、インポートすることもできます。たとえば、SAP ノート 3322100 には、さまざまな目的で調整できる複数のサンプルルールが用意されています。詳細については、SAP Support Portal (https://support.sap.com/en/index.html) を参照してください。
論理演算子 (AND、OR、NOT) を使用して 2 つの基本ルールを結合することによって形成される複合ルールを示す図。この図は、点線で結ばれた (基本ルール 1 および基本ルール 2) と、基本ルール 3 に接続する論理演算子 AND を示しています。結果は、True または <> True になります。

残高チェックには、以下の 2 つのタイプのルールがあります。

  1. 基本ルール - これらのルールは、2 つの異なる式を比較する式です。"左側の式" には、分析されるデータのユーザ定義計算が含まれています。"右論理式" には、チェック基準として使用されるデータが含まれています。
  2. 複合ルール - これらのルールは、論理演算子 (AND、OR、NOT) で連結された基本ルールで構成されます。これらの有効期間は TRUE と等しいか等しくないかがチェックされます。

残高チェックの基本ルール

Max は、残高チェックルールのコンセプトをより完全に理解するようになりました。管理者から受け取ったチェック情報に基づいて、システムに基本ルールを登録します。ビジネス設定エキスパートと協力して、ルールをシステムに取り込みます。

残高チェックの考慮事項

検証情報を取得したら、いくつかの項目を考慮する必要があります。

  • ルールを作成しやすくするために、特定のオブジェクトグループが必要ですか。
  • グローバル階層を登録する必要がありますか。
  • どの詳細レベルを表示しますか。これは、概要レベルが高い場合もあれば、原価センタ、G/L 勘定、資産などの個別オブジェクトまで詳細である場合もあります。

基本ルールは、2 つの主要セクション (一般情報とルール式) で構成されます。また、補足的な [参照リンク] セクションも含まれています。

  • 一般情報 - ルールの動作を示します。
  • ルール式 - データ比較の計算を指定します。
  • 参照リンク - 関連する外部文書をリンクします。

一般情報セクション

ルール ID、説明 (短)、説明 (長)、およびデータソースやコントロールレベルなどのさまざまなドロップダウンオプションの項目が表示されている、一般情報セクションの新規ルールインタフェースのスクリーンショット。上部のタブには、一般情報、ルール式、および参照リンクが含まれます。

一般情報セクションでは、ルールがどのように機能するかが決定され、以下の項目が含まれます。

  • ルール ID - ルールの識別名。最大 10 文字です。文字 "S" は、SAP 提供アイテム用に予約された名称領域であるため、先頭を "S" にすることはできません。
  • テキスト (短)/テキスト (長) - ルールのコンセプトを識別するための意味のある内容説明です。テキスト (短) は最大 40 文字、テキスト (長) は最大 120 文字です。
  • データソース - この項目は、情報の取得元であり、会計管理に初期設定されます。もう 1 つの可能性は、グループレポートです。このコースでは、会計データソースにのみ焦点を当てます。
  • グループ化基準項目 - この項目により、チェック結果の詳細ページにおけるデータの編成方法が決定されます。最大 6 つの異なるグループ化基準を設定することができます。グループ化は順次適用され、最後に指定したフィールドのみが検証されます。
  • 許容範囲 - 許容値または許容パーセント (もしくはその両方) を定義します。チェック時にすべての値が選択した通貨で表示されるように、ここで通貨を定義することができます。
  • データなしを以下として処理 - システムで表示されるデータがない場合の対処方法。オプションは、正常終了 (警告あり) 、失敗、またはゼロです。
  • 制御レベル - チェック結果でルール合格の失敗が許容されるかどうかを指定します。使用可能な値は、エラー、警告、および情報です。
  • コメント必須 - チェック結果アプリの詳細ページで追加の説明を提供するためにコメントが必要な場合は、このチェックボックスを選択します。

ルール式セクション

ルールエディタインタフェースの [ルール式] タブのスクリーンショット。関数のドロップダウンメニューを含む [左論理式] および [右論理式] のセクションが表示されています。以下のオペランド式エディタには、エイリアス、オペランド、期間、場所、および値の項目と、オペランドを追加またはリセットするオプションが含まれています。

ルール式セクションでは、比較するデータの計算方法 (左論理式と呼ばれる) と、それを比較する参照データ (右論理式と呼ばれる) を指定します。左右の式の間の領域は比較演算子と呼ばれ、これら 2 つの式の比較方法を決定します。これには、より大きい、より小さい、または等しい、等しくないなどの演算子が含まれます。

オペランド式エディタは、式ボックスの入力に使用されるツールです。ルールを登録したら、使用する前に、ルールを保存して有効化する必要があります。

式の作成時には、いくつかの制限に対処する必要があります。G/L 勘定に基づいてフィルタを定義する場合、以下の明細を含む財務諸表バージョン (FSV) ノードを使用することはできません。

  • 正味結果: 損失、正味結果: 利益、損益結果などの特殊ノード
  • 他の FSV ノードの見合ノードに設定されているノード
  • 見合ノード、銀行勘定グループ化、再グループ化増分などの設定による G/L 勘定の複製
  • 機能領域

これは、これらのノードにチェック実行ではまだサポートされていない特別な計算ロジックが含まれているためです。他の FSV ノードを使用するか、G/L 勘定階層のノードを使用することができます。

基本ルールの登録

ルールの作成を開始するには、残高チェックルールおよびグループ管理アプリケーションにアクセスします。このアプリケーションを使用して、残高チェックルールおよびグループの両方を登録します。このコースの後半で、残高チェックグループについて説明します。ここでは、基本ルールの登録方法を見ていきましょう。

[ルール] タブを確認するときに、[作成] をクリックし、作成するルールの種類を選択することができます。ここでは、基本ルールに焦点を当てます。

残高チェックの基本ルールの登録

今月と前月の間の原価センタ値を分析する残高チェック基本ルールを登録するよう依頼されました。前の演習問題では、グローバル階層管理アプリケーションを使用して、BVCCH### として識別された原価センタのこのグループを登録しました。このルールでは、各原価センタの金額が前期間の 120% を超えないように決定する必要があります。

残高チェック基本ルールシミュレーション

Max は基本ルールを登録しましたが、そのルールが想定どおりに機能していることを確認するためにテストする必要があります。Max は、登録したばかりのルールに対してチェックシミュレート機能を使用します。

基本ルールシミュレーション設定

基本ルールをシミュレートするには、行の最後にあるナビゲーション矢印を選択して、ルールの詳細画面を表示する必要があります。シミュレートを選択すると、プロセスを開始することができます。

分析するデータの関連基準 (会社コード、原価センタ、利益センタ、元帳、通貨、会計期間、年度など) を指定する必要があります。

  1. 詳細画面にナビゲートします。
    • 行の最後にあるナビゲーション矢印をクリックして、シミュレートするルールの詳細画面に移動します。
  2. シミュレーションプロセスを開始します。
    • "シミュレート" ボタンをクリックします。
  3. 関連する基準を指定します。
    • 会社コードを入力します。
    • 原価センタを入力します。
    • 利益センタを入力します。
    • 元帳を入力します。
    • 通貨を入力します。
    • 会計期間を入力します。
    • 年を入力

次の演習問題では、ユーザが基本ルールをシミュレートすることができます。ステップに従ってルールをテストし、期待どおりに実行されることを確認します。

残高チェック基本ルールのシミュレーション

残高チェックの基本ルールを登録した後、このルールをテストして、正しく構築されていることを確認します。シミュレーション機能を使用して、このタスクを完了します。シミュレーションの準備として、一般仕訳アップロードプログラムと既存ファイルを使用してシステムにデータを入力する必要があります。

残高チェックの複合ルール

Max は、残高チェックの基本ルールについて理解し、複合ルールに関する知識を必要としています。

複合ルールは、AND、OR、NOT などの論理演算子によって接続された基本ルールで構成されます。この場合、チェックは 2 つの異なるルールを比較するため、基本ルールとは異なります。結果は TRUE または FALSE のいずれかになります。真の場合、チェックに合格します。true (または false) でない場合は、検証の失敗を示します。

たとえば、引当金を転記する場合、引当金負債勘定と引当金費用勘定にエントリが存在する必要があります。引当金額がゼロではなく、引当金原価がゼロでないことをチェックする単一ルールを登録することができます。次に、残高が有効であることを判断するために、両方の単一ルールが真であることを検証する複合ルールを登録します。

基本ルールと同様に、複合ルールには 2 つの主要セクション (一般情報およびルール式) と、外部文書に接続するための参照リンクセクションが含まれています。ただし、これらの項目は、ルールの登録方法により制限されます。

一般情報、ルール式、および参照リンクのセクションが表示されている、複合ルールを作成するための新規ルールインタフェースのスクリーンショット。ルール式セクションには、左論理式および右論理式のテキストボックスと、基本ルールと論理演算子を追加するオプションがあります。一方、一般情報セクションには、ルール ID、説明、およびコントロールレベルの項目が含まれています。

一般情報セクション

一般情報セクションでは、ルールの動作が決定され、以下の項目が含まれます。

  • ルール ID - 最大 10 文字の識別名。文字 "S" で開始することはできません。
  • テキスト (短)/テキスト (長) - ルールのコンセプトを識別するための意味のある内容説明です。テキスト (短) は最大 40 文字、テキスト (長) は最大 120 文字です。
  • 制御レベル - チェック結果でルール合格の失敗が許容されるかどうかを指定します。
  • コメント必須 - このチェックボックスは、チェック結果アプリの詳細ページで追加の説明を提供するためにコメントが必要な場合に選択します。

ルール式セクション

ルール式セクションでは、比較するデータの計算方法が決定されます。

  • 左論理式 - 基本ルールの比較方法が表示されます。
  • Right Formula - 静的であり、常に TRUE に設定されます。
  • 比較演算子 - 左論理式と右論理式間のスペースです。"等しい" や "等しくない" などのデータの比較方法を記述します。比較を FALSE にする必要がある場合は、比較演算子を変更します。

オペランド式エディタは、式ボックスの入力に使用されるツールです。

注記

論理式では、論理演算子 AND および OR の優先度が同じであり、左から右に計算されることに注意してください。NOT の優先度は高くなります。評価の順序を変更するには、括弧を使用します。

論理演算子は以下のように機能します。

  • AND - 演算子によって接続された 2 つの基本ルールの評価が TRUE である場合に TRUE の値を返します。
  • OR - 演算子によって接続された 2 つの基本ルールのいずれかが TRUE と評価された場合、TRUE の値を返します。
  • NOT - この演算子に続く基本ルールの結果の評価を取り消します。

ルールを登録したら、使用する前に、ルールを保存して有効化する必要があります。

複合ルールの登録

ルールの作成を開始するには、残高チェックルールおよびグループ管理アプリケーションにアクセスします。このアプリケーションを使用して、残高チェックルールおよびグループの両方を登録します。

[ルール] タブを確認するときに、[作成] をクリックし、作成するルールの種類を選択することができます。ここでは、複合ルールに焦点を当てます。

重要ポイント

  • 基本ルールは、2 つの異なる式を比較する式です。
  • 複合ルールは、論理演算子 AND、OR、NOT によって結合された基本ルールで構成されます。これらのルールの結果は、true または false とみなされます。

残高チェック複合ルールの登録

引当金負債が存在する場合、費用明細も入力されていることを決定する残高チェックルールを登録する必要があります。これを行うには、最初に各カテゴリの年初来金額がゼロでないかどうかを決定する必要があります。これらは、別の同僚によってシステムにすでに入力されている基本ルールです。タスクは、これら 2 つの基本ルールを使用して残高チェック複合ルールを登録し、両方の明細が真であることを確認します。ルールを保存します。ただし、有効化しないでください。

Log in to track your progress & complete quizzes